Birthday Present

Apron

Christel Nieske’s birthday fell during the difficult time shortly after they arrived in the West. Although the reception process left them little free time and money was tight, they celebrated anyway. She even received a present: a new apron.

Christel Nieske remembers:

“Although my aunts had smuggled money to the West for us before we fled, we were not well off financially because of the unfavorable exchange rates. There were daily fluctuations so we tried to minimize our losses by only exchanging small amounts. We only received 486.55 West DM for 3,020.30 East DM, which meant that our East mark was suddenly only worth about 16 Pfennigs. We couldn’t make any major purchases with that, but on my birthday, on February 17, I received an apron and a pair of nylon stockings. I used the apron for many years, but the stockings turned out to be a bad buy.”
